Description

Shaped ring nut
The subject matter of the invention is a shaped ring nut dedicated to bolt connections used to connect machine and device elements.
There exist solutions for bolt connections using typical nuts without shaped elements in which the rotation is locked with wrenches.
There is invention DE3147615, in which the nut has a round conical collar. The nut in the hole is fixed before mounting by pressing it in the hole.
There also exist solutions for connecting elements made of sheets or plates, in which the nut is permanently installed by being pressed or welded in a circular hole made in a sheet or plate.
The object of the invention is to provide a shaped ring nut that prevents rotation of the nut, wherein the shaped ring has any shape (non-rounded), which allows to eliminate the degree of freedom being the rotation of the nut around its own axis. According to the invention, the nut can be part of bolt connections used for connecting machine components and devices.
According to the invention, the essence of the solution lies in the fact that on one side on the frontal surface, the nut has an additional ring of any external shape allowing the elimination of the degree of freedom being the rotation of the nut around its own axis. During assembly, an additional ring of any shape is installed in a shaped hole made in one of the connected elements.
It is preferable if the outer shape of the additional ring is polygonal, in particular a quadrangle, a triangle, a regular polygon or an irregular polygon or a star polygon.
In other variant, it is preferable if the outer shape of the additional ring is any oval.
Preferably the nut with an integrated shape ring can have an additional plastic ring placed inside to protect the connection against self-loosening.
Additionally, in another embodiment, it is beneficial if the outer surface of the ring is inclined, as it allows tight installation of the nut in the shaped hole. The height of the additional ring is smaller than the thickness of the connected element.
The following technical and operational results have been obtained by using the solution according to the invention:
· no need to use a wrench to block the rotation of the nut,
• the possibility of using the solution in hard-to-reach places,
• no need to use additional elements protecting against self-loosening,
• assembly with one hand. The subject matter of the solution is shown in the drawing, where fig. 1 shows the isometric view from the side of the collar, fig. 2 shows a side view, fig. 3 shows the view and cross-section of the solution with an inclined surface, fig. 4 shows isometric view of an example of application, fig. 5-11 shows exemplary shapes of the outer ring, fig. 12-13 shows examples of how to insert the nut in the hole.
The nut shown in the drawing is shaped in such a way that, on one side of the frontal face 1, it has an additional ring 2 of any external shape 3 permitting the elimination of the degree of freedom being the rotation of the nut around its own axis. The height h of the ring is smaller than the height of the connected element in which the nut is installed.
There are embodiments where the outer shape 3 of the additional ring 2 is any regular polygon, especially a triangle (fig. 5), a quadrangle (fig. 6), a pentagon (fig. 7), a hexagon (fig. 8), an irregular polygon (fig. 9) or a star polygon (fig. 10).
In other embodiment, it is beneficial if the outer shape of the additional ring
2 is oval (fig. 11).
In another embodiment, the shaped nut with integrated shaped ring 2 can have an additional plastic ring placed inside to protect the connection against self- loosening. There is a variant, where the outer surface of the ring 2 is inclined, which allows tight installation of the nut in the shaped hole.
Connecting machine and device elements with a nut according to the invention consists in having at least two connected layers 6 with holes made, while in the last layer a shaped hole 7 is made in a shape corresponding to the shape of the shaped ring 2 of the nut, in which the nut with an additional shaped ring 2 will be installed. Then, in the hole made from the connection of bolted elements, a bolt is placed and in the last layer a nut with an additional shaped ring is placed in the shaped hole.
To facilitate installing of the nuts in the shaped hole, it is beneficial to perform additional notches in the element in which the nut is installed, as presented in fig. 12-13.

Claims

Claims
Shaped ring nut characterised in that, on one side on the frontal face (1) it has an additional ring (2) of any outer shape (3) allowing the elimination of the degree of freedom being the rotation of the nut around its own axis. The nut according to claim 1 characterised in that, the outer shape (3) of the additional ring (2) is any regular polygon, in particular a triangle, a quadrangle, a pentagon, a hexagon, an irregular polygon or a star polygon. The nut according to claim 1 characterised in that, the outer shape (3) of the additional ring (2) is any oval.
The nut according to claims 1, 2, 3 characterised in that, the outer surface of the ring (2) is an inclined surface.
The nut according to claims 1, 2, 3, 4 characterised in that, it can have an additional plastic ring placed inside to protect the connection against self- loosening.
